[llvm] r319831 - [ModRefInfo] Initialize ArgMask to MRI_NoModRef.

Alina Sbirlea via llvm-commits llvm-commits at lists.llvm.org
Tue Dec 5 12:51:20 PST 2017


Author: asbirlea
Date: Tue Dec  5 12:51:20 2017
New Revision: 319831

URL: http://llvm.org/viewvc/llvm-project?rev=319831&view=rev
Log:
[ModRefInfo] Initialize ArgMask to MRI_NoModRef.

Modified:
    llvm/trunk/lib/Analysis/AliasAnalysis.cpp

Modified: llvm/trunk/lib/Analysis/AliasAnalysis.cpp
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/lib/Analysis/AliasAnalysis.cpp?rev=319831&r1=319830&r2=319831&view=diff
==============================================================================
--- llvm/trunk/lib/Analysis/AliasAnalysis.cpp (original)
+++ llvm/trunk/lib/Analysis/AliasAnalysis.cpp Tue Dec  5 12:51:20 2017
@@ -263,7 +263,7 @@ ModRefInfo AAResults::getModRefInfo(Immu
         // - If CS2 modifies location, dependence exists if CS1 reads or writes.
         // - If CS2 only reads location, dependence exists if CS1 writes.
         ModRefInfo ArgModRefCS2 = getArgModRefInfo(CS2, CS2ArgIdx);
-        ModRefInfo ArgMask;
+        ModRefInfo ArgMask = MRI_NoModRef;
         if (isModSet(ArgModRefCS2))
           ArgMask = MRI_ModRef;
         else if (isRefSet(ArgModRefCS2))




More information about the llvm-commits mailing list